Virtues

Our core virtues form our way of life before God and our increasingly complex world. We begin and end with the God of Scripture, who reveals his character and nature through original and ultimate tension—he is one and three, just and merciful, powerful and compassionate. Therefore, we experience him and his world through tensions. This is God’s world and ours. Our human experience is beautiful and broken. Simply put, such sacred tensions in Creator and creation inform our core virtues and commitments to:

  1. A High View of Text & Context – as the incarnate word of God, Christ is truly divine and truly human. Likewise, as the written word of God, Scripture also exhibits truly divine and truly human qualities through God's engagement with human communities, languages, and cultures over thousands of years. Therefore, as we preach, teach, pray, serve, and lead, our way of life holds our authoritative text in one hand and our emerging contexts (theological, literary, cultural, historical, etc.) in the other.

  2. A High View of Openness & Critique – our increasingly digital and polarized world can contribute to a lack of thorough, nuanced understanding. Therefore, we build knowledge and skills through multi-generational, multi-cultural, and multi-disciplinary dialogue. This allows us to recognize strengths in others' perspectives and limitations in our own. While challenging, our hope is to not sound off like the next echo chamber but instead, to engage with Christlike, Spirit-filled wisdom.

  3. A High View of Health & Growth – in Scripture, faithfulness to God's covenant and fruitfulness in his mission are two sides of the same coin. Communities and leaders who increasingly stand before God must increasingly advocate for underserved people groups. As such, Christ expanded movements to prioritize those on the margins. Therefore, in Christ and by his Spirit, we connect with, coach, and care for people to grow quantitatively and qualitatively, increasing in number and advocacy.
